(線切割數(shù)控機(jī)床)線切割機(jī)床閉環(huán)控制設(shè)計(jì)
目前在線切割機(jī)中當(dāng)系統(tǒng)發(fā)出一個(gè)進(jìn)給指令,經(jīng)驅(qū)動(dòng)電路功率放大,驅(qū)動(dòng)電機(jī)旋轉(zhuǎn)一個(gè)角度,再經(jīng)齒輪減速裝置帶動(dòng)絲杠旋轉(zhuǎn),通過絲杠螺母機(jī)構(gòu)轉(zhuǎn)換為機(jī)床的直線位移。機(jī)床各個(gè)軸的移動(dòng)速度與位移量由輸入脈沖的頻率與脈沖數(shù)所決定。此時(shí)機(jī)床的信息流是單向的,即進(jìn)給脈沖發(fā)出后,實(shí)際移動(dòng)值不再反饋回來。系統(tǒng)對(duì)機(jī)床的實(shí)際位移量不進(jìn)行監(jiān)測(cè),也不能進(jìn)行誤差校正。因此步進(jìn)電動(dòng)機(jī)的失步、步距角誤差、齒輪與絲杠等傳動(dòng)誤差都將影響被加工零件的精度。為了提高機(jī)床的精度,采用直線電機(jī)和位置檢測(cè)元件組成閉環(huán)系統(tǒng)。它消除了旋轉(zhuǎn)電機(jī)齒輪間隙帶來的誤差,減小了系統(tǒng)的慣性,改善了系統(tǒng)的動(dòng)態(tài)性能。電機(jī)能否精確定位,取決于位置反饋是否精確,光柵尺精度高、價(jià)位低、性能優(yōu)良、故其成為首選傳感器,以實(shí)現(xiàn)位置信號(hào)的反饋。
光柵尺信號(hào)輸出頻率很高,如直接給工控機(jī)讀取,實(shí)時(shí)性難以保證,采用高性能工控機(jī)雖能實(shí)現(xiàn),但需編制大量程序。設(shè)計(jì)光柵尺接口模塊,能實(shí)現(xiàn)信號(hào)的細(xì)分、辯向、位置的計(jì)算與顯示。模塊是獨(dú)立工作的,上位機(jī)何時(shí)需要數(shù)據(jù),通過數(shù)據(jù)總線直接讀取即可。既保證控制系統(tǒng)的實(shí)時(shí)性,提高了系統(tǒng)的反應(yīng)速度。采用的光柵尺分辨率為1µm。
光柵尺信號(hào)
光柵尺輸出信號(hào)是電信號(hào),動(dòng)尺移動(dòng)一個(gè)柵距,輸出電信號(hào)便變化一個(gè)周期,它是通過對(duì)信號(hào)變化周期的測(cè)量來測(cè)出移動(dòng)的相對(duì)位移。計(jì)數(shù)器所計(jì)數(shù)乘以光柵距即為直線電機(jī)所走的位移。
輸出信號(hào)是相位角相差90º時(shí),方向?yàn)檎粗疄樨?fù)。Z信號(hào)作為校準(zhǔn)信號(hào)以消除累積誤差。
在A信號(hào)怕下降沿采集B信號(hào),就可判斷出運(yùn)動(dòng)方向。當(dāng)A信號(hào)的上升沿及下降沿均比B信號(hào)超前1/4W,在A信號(hào)下降沿采集的B信號(hào)為“1”,此時(shí)為正向運(yùn)動(dòng);A信號(hào)的上升沿及下降沿均比B信號(hào)滯后1/4W,在A信號(hào)下降沿采集到的B信號(hào)為“0”,此時(shí)為反向運(yùn)動(dòng)。根據(jù)采集到的運(yùn)動(dòng)信號(hào)方向和A信號(hào)變化的周期數(shù)用計(jì)數(shù)器進(jìn)行計(jì)數(shù)(正向計(jì)數(shù)或逆向計(jì)數(shù)),就可測(cè)算出總位移。
計(jì)數(shù)電路
本系統(tǒng)中采用8254實(shí)現(xiàn)計(jì)數(shù)功能。正反向脈沖PX,NX分別作為計(jì)數(shù)器8254的時(shí)鐘CLK,輸出信號(hào)即為位移的脈沖數(shù)。地址線A0、A1與8254的片選取線一起確定8254的地址。
接口電路
設(shè)計(jì)接口電路時(shí),主要考慮3方面因素;
(1)總線負(fù)載。當(dāng)CPU讀插件板上的內(nèi)存或接口時(shí),內(nèi)存芯片式接口芯片將數(shù)據(jù)傳送到系統(tǒng)總線的數(shù)據(jù)總線上,此時(shí)數(shù)據(jù)總線上的所有負(fù)載都將成為內(nèi)存芯片式接口芯片的負(fù)載。為了保證總線的正常工作,在接口電路中要增加雙向數(shù)據(jù)驅(qū)動(dòng)。
(2)總線的競(jìng)爭(zhēng)。PC機(jī)屬于獨(dú)立式I/O接口尋址方式,對(duì)一個(gè)地址,計(jì)算機(jī)可有I/O讀寫、DMA讀寫和存儲(chǔ)器讀寫,它們地址譯碼中加入AEN信號(hào),避免DMA操作不會(huì)選通I/O地址。存儲(chǔ)器I/O接口地址易產(chǎn)生混淆,利用硬件電路進(jìn)行存取,避免了總線競(jìng)爭(zhēng)。只當(dāng)CPU讀接口卡時(shí),才允許通向系統(tǒng)數(shù)據(jù)線的三態(tài)門導(dǎo)通,其他任何時(shí)刻這些三態(tài)門必須呈現(xiàn)高阻狀態(tài)。
(3)接口保護(hù)。接口電路還應(yīng)考慮由于接口電路出現(xiàn)故障或工作時(shí)的誤動(dòng)作對(duì)計(jì)算機(jī)造成的損壞。
基于ISA總線的接口電路設(shè)計(jì)
(1)緩沖器有保護(hù)功能設(shè)計(jì)
用八同相雙向三志緩沖器/驅(qū)動(dòng)器芯片SN74HC245緩沖ISA總線擴(kuò)展槽與各器件間的8位數(shù)據(jù)信號(hào)。SN74HC245不但起緩沖、隔離作用,還有一定的保護(hù)和控制作用。工控機(jī)讀控制信號(hào)(低電平有效)邊接到SN74HC245的DIR(方向控制端),而門控信號(hào)接信號(hào)CS245。CS245W信號(hào)是I/O端口讀寫信號(hào)和接口地址譯碼信號(hào)產(chǎn)生的信號(hào)。當(dāng)讀有效為低電平時(shí),8254的數(shù)據(jù)可通過SN74HC245輸入到計(jì)算機(jī);讀有效為高電平時(shí),計(jì)算機(jī)的數(shù)據(jù)輸出。CS245實(shí)現(xiàn)只有計(jì)算機(jī)與8254交換數(shù)據(jù)時(shí),選通SN74HC245的門控信號(hào)G,使之三態(tài)門打開。
線切割數(shù)控機(jī)床
郵箱:szxr1123@163.com
地址:蘇州市相城區(qū)黃橋工業(yè)園永方路168號(hào)